How they compare
Bhutan currently reports 0.0104 number per person against 0.0098 number per person in Burundi, a difference of 0.0006 number per person.
That makes Bhutan's figure about 1.1 times Burundi's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 16 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Burundi ahead.
Bhutan ranks 173rd and Burundi ranks 176th of 199 countries.
Burundi has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
